Refrigeration Diagnostics
BEFORE BEGINNING SERVICE
Ice machines may experience operational problems
only during certain times of the day or night. A machine
may function properly while it is being serviced, but
malfunctions later. Information provided by the user can
help the technician start in the right direction, and may be
a determining factor in the final diagnosis.
Ask these questions before beginning service:
When does the ice machine malfunction? (night, day,
all the time, only during the Freeze cycle, etc.)
When do you notice low ice production? (one day a
week, every day, on weekends, etc.)
Can you describe exactly what the ice machine seems
to be doing?
Has anyone been working on the ice machine?
During “store shutdown,” is the circuit breaker, water
supply or air temperature altered?
Is there any reason why incoming water pressure
might rise or drop substantially?
INSTALLATION/VISUAL INSPECTION CHECKLIST
Possible Problem List Corrective Action List
Filter and/or condenser is dirty. Clean the filter and condenser.
Water filtration is plugged (if
used).
Install a new water filter.
Water drain is not vented or is
improperly installed.
Run and vent drains according
to the installation manual.
